LONDON (AFP) - A customer trying to call telecoms operator BT Group was left hanging on the telephone for a total of 20 hours, The Times newspaper reported here on Saturday.

Hannah King, 51, called a company helpline after a BT engineer failed to turn up to install a telephone line at her new flat in Milford Haven, according to the paper.

For eight hours in a row, she endured the sound of piped music. She gave up and tried again the next day -- and waited another eight hours before putting the phone down.

The following day, she spent a further four hours on hold before hanging up.

That took the total time wasted to almost one day, the paper said.

"I was so frustrated and angry I broke down in tears," she told The Times.

"It is a helpline for goodness' sake, surely a company as big as BT can answer their phones."

BT admitted that a new calling system had left some customers in the lurch.

"BT would like to apologise for the length of time this customer was left on the phone," the paper quoted a BT spokeswoman as saying.
